2007: Started a career-high 53 games, serving primarily as Miami's centerfielder ... set new career highs in nearly every offensive category, including batting average (.251 BA), home runs (4), doubles (9), triples (1), hits (42), walks (10) and RBIs (20) ... hit two of her four home runs in conference play, swatting one round tripper against Akron (March 30) and Ohio (March 31) ... batted in a career-high four runs with her pinch-hit grand slam against Maine (Feb. 23). It was Robinson's first career grand slam ... notched eight multi-hit games and four multi-RBI games ... had a season-high three hits in a 3-for-4 effort at Toledo (April 14) ... one of six Miamians to start all 22 conference games ... hit first career triple against Fairfield (March 16). 2006: Miami's starting centerfielder for the bulk of the season ... made 43 of her 45 starts in centerfield ... batted a career-high .248 and also set new career highs in home runs (3), doubles (5), RBIs (13), hits (31), runs (17), at-bats (125) and walks (7) ... notched a season-long six-game hitting streak from Feb. 10-19 ... clubbed first home run of the season against Utah Valley State (Feb. 19), a two-run, go-ahead blast ... also left the yard against Northern Illinois (April 9) and Toledo (April 14) ... her home run against Northern Illinois was part of a three-home-run fourth inning for Miami ... her long ball against the Rockets was the RedHawks' 28th of the season, breaking the old team record of 27 ... tied a career game-high with four two-RBI games, including a pair at the Troy Cox Classic (Feb. 17-19) ... also had six multi-hit games on the season, with four coming in MAC play ... swiped six bases ... finished 2-for-4 in Miami's upset win over Ohio State (April 19). 2005: Started 34 games, 33 in the outfield and one at designated player ... played 49 games in all ... homered at Texas A&M, then ranked No. 11 and No. 15 in the nation, on Mar. 5 ... homered again in Miami's first MAC Tournament game against Bowling Green (5/11), a 2-0 RedHawk win ... had a 3-for-3 game against Butler (Apr. 21) in which she also scored three runs and stole three bases ... third on the team in stolen bases, with eight in 10 attempts ... in Miami's second game of the MAC Tournament, had a 2-for-3 day against Central Michigan on the way to an 8-2 Miami win ... handled 33 of 35 chances in the field. High School: Lettered three years each in basketball and volleyball and two years in softball at Toledo Central Catholic High School ... earned first-team all-city honors in both of her last two seasons ... first-team all-district as a senior ... as a senior, batted .429 with 17 RBI ... stole 17 of 20 bases and had a .973 fielding percentage her final year. Personal: Born May 26, 1986 ... daughter of Diane and Brian Robinson ... exercise science major ... sister of former Miami WR/PR Ryne Robinson who was drafted by the NFL's Carolina Panthers in 2007. |
